Job Description
You will be an Economist/Senior Economist within the Economics, Research and Market Intelligence Unit of our Cost Management business, providing construction cost information and economic trends to business stakeholders. You will work on a variety of Turner & Townsend projects and initiatives. These range from the production of the companies’ externally facing economic research documents to client focused, fee earning reports.
Key accountabilities
- Economic forecasting; model specification and estimation
- Evaluate macroeconomic and microeconomic trends that have a direct/indirect effect on the construction industry
- Prepare written reports and presentations to senior management, key clients and regional costs centres
- Development, analysis and maintenance of corporate datasets and reports
- Supporting the development of new data-driven services, solutions and products
- Providing technical expertise, training and support to non-experts
- Liaising with and gathering data and information from both technical and non-technical stakeholders
- Manage aspects of economics research team and commissions as needed
- Establishing friendly and professional relationships with clients, colleagues and other parties involved in the projects and programmes we support.
Desirable skills and experience
Previous experience or a sound and suitable understanding of the following will be a distinct advantage in applying for this role:
- Broad knowledge of the construction industry
- Knowledge of a programming language or willingness to learn; STATA, R, E-Views, SAS or similar statistical platforms
- Understanding of visual analytics software or willingness to learn; Tableau and Microsoft Power BI are of particular interest
- Knowledge of econometric techniques: economic impact assessment; cost benefit analysis; and forecasting models are desirable
- Excellent written and oral communication skills, including the ability to explain economic concepts and quantitative results, as well as their implications, to non-specialists, in plain English for a business audience
- Proficiency in Excel
- Ability to work using own initiative and without close supervision.
Qualifications
- Undergraduate Degree (or equivalent) in a course that is Economics based entirely, or as part of a joint honours programme
- Masters in Economics, Finance, Statistics or Mathematics (or related subjects) is sought
- Ideally hold or be working towards an appropriate professional body membership or equivalent.
- Fluent in English and German (min. B1)
